Church of Scotland
The Church of Presbyterianism in Scotland. According to its creed, it is a part of the Apostolic and Universal Catholic Church. In Scotland, Christianity was introduced by Saint Ninian (c. 400) from the continent and Saint Columbanus (c. 563) from Ireland toward the end of the Roman occupation of Britain, and the so-called Celtic Church was established and developed in close ties with the Church of Rome. The monarchy prevailed In the 16th century, Scotland was under the control of the French royal family, and the Reformation developed in conjunction with the liberation movement. At first it was under the influence of Lutheranism, but later Calvinism became dominant under J. Knox, and there was a long-running dispute over whether to have an episcopal or presbyterian system, especially between the monarchy, which favored the former, and the parliament, which favored the latter. Thanks to the efforts of A. Melville, presbyterianism was recognized in 1592, but similar disputes continued with the monarchy, and in 1638 and 1643, covenants to protect presbyterianism were made between the king and the parliament. However, dissatisfied with the King's breach of the covenant and the compromise made by Parliament, the radical Covenanters left the Church of Scotland. At the same time, overseas missionary work began in the 19th century, with India being the main stage. However, from the 19th to the 20th century, there was a renewed movement towards church unity, and in 1929 the Church of Scotland was united. It is a member of the World Council of Churches, and has been in dialogue with the Church of England since 1932.
